There are two types of associated costs, i.e. fixed cost and variable cost.
The fixed cost of renting the truck is given as $20.99, and the variable cost is the charge of per mile driven, given as 86 cents per mile (= $0.86 per mile).
Then the total cost of renting the truck is given by,
[tex]\text{Total Cost=Fixed Cost+Variable Cost}[/tex]Let 'x' be the number of miles driven.
Then the total variable cost is given by,
[tex]\begin{gathered} \text{Variable cost=No. of miles}\times\text{ Cost per mile} \\ \text{Variable cost=x}\times\text{ 0}.86 \\ \text{Variable cost=0}.86x \end{gathered}[/tex]Substitute the values,
[tex]\begin{gathered} \text{220.51=20.99+0.86x} \\ 0.86x=220.51-20.99 \\ 0.86x=199.52 \\ x=\frac{199.52}{0.86} \\ x=232 \end{gathered}[/tex]Thus, Frank drove the truck 232 miles.
